Phoenicia, Aradus, (early 4th century B.C.), silver stater, (10.60 g), obv. head of marine deity to right, with laurel wreath, dotted border, rev. galley to waves below, above in Phoenician 'ex Arado' not dated, (cf.S.5971, Betlyon 10 [fourth Aradian Series], BMC 21-23, Pl.I, 15 [square flans]). Square flan, otherwise very good/nearly very fine.

Ex Noble Numismatics Auction Sale 77 (lot 3221).
